Summary
The unicode character "怌" at code point U+600C is a CJK (Chinese Japanese Korean) ideogram meaning "bosom, to carry in the bosom, or to cherish". It is a character in the CJK Unified Ideographs block and is part of the Han script. The character is an other letter. The UTF-8 encoding of "怌" is 0xE6 0x80 0x8C and the UTF-16 encoding is 0x600C.
